i photochopped my first smilie, but i can't seem to finish it.
how the heck can i make the back on this .gif transparent... i just want to see the smilie, not it's white background (the white behind the smilie, not the white in his sign).
any help would be appreciated!
Midnight 02-19-2003, 11:21 PM use the magic wand to select the white parts. then say "select inverse" copy (CTRL+C) it. Make a new picture (The dimensions will already be good, it uses the dimensions of whatever is on your clipboard). Paste. now should should have the smilie with the sign, on top of the background, which is transparent. now here is the important part. DO NOT FLATTEN THE IMAGE. just go to save as, and then save it as a .gif
